Flights from Málaga to Newcastle depart on average 65 times per day, taking around 3h 15m. Cheap flight tickets for this journey start at $28 (€22) if you book in advance.
There are 9 flights per day. The earliest flight runs at 04:25, the last at 23:55. The fastest flight covers the 1150 miles (1851 km) distance in 3h 15m. June is the cheapest month to fly.
